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
cancel
Showing results for 
Search instead for 
Did you mean: 
samuel_rodrigue
Contributor III
Contributor III

Ticket Médio SET ANALYSIS

Olá,

Estou tentando montar uma expressão de ticket médico por cliente, porém o valor não está correto:

A expressão que estou usando é a seguinte:

sum({<$(vFiltroNAC_FAT), STATUS={'FATURADO'}, VENDEDOR = {'VS'}, ORIGEM_DA_ORDEM = {'CRM ','Online'} >} $(vValorLiqLiq))

/

count({<$(vFiltroNAC_FAT), $(vValorLiqLiq) = {">0"}, STATUS={'FATURADO'}, VENDEDOR_AGRUPADOR = {'VS'}>} distinct(CLIENTE))

No gráfico essa expressão está resultando em: 
Capturar.PNG

Porém o resultado devia ser a soma desses dois valores sublinhados na tabela:

image.png

Desde já agradeço.

 

7 Replies
andersons
Contributor II
Contributor II

Olá,

Esses valores sublinhados correspondem ao mês de março 2019?

Att,

Anderson Santos

RafaMartins
Creator II
Creator II

isto $(vValorLiqLiq) é uma variável? 

samuel_rodrigue
Contributor III
Contributor III
Author

Exato!

samuel_rodrigue
Contributor III
Contributor III
Author

É a variável do valor $$, considero apenas variável para poder alterar de Dólar para Reais em um botão em alguns Dashs.
RafaMartins
Creator II
Creator II

Olha, por sua expressão conter muitas variáveis fica difícil te dizer onde pode estar errado sem seu modelo de dados.

O que você pode fazer e realizar essa conta por partes e verificar se cada parte te retorna o valor esperado.

outros detalhe é que algumas variáveis que podem não aceitar dimensão. 

samuel_rodrigue
Contributor III
Contributor III
Author

O esquisito, é que quando coloco a expressão na tabela como na foto ali, ela calcula  valor certo porém no somatório ela exibe o mesmo valor do gráfico:

image.png

RafaMartins
Creator II
Creator II

alguma parte do seu set depende de dimensão para apresentar valor, sugiro que desmembre a expressão e analise por parte e se cada parte apresenta o valor esperado. faça isso com as variáveis também.

o mais provável é que algo esteja errado na parte do count